This recipe SERVES 6.
Weight Watchers Tater Tot Casserole
1 can (10.5 oz) 98% fat-free condensed cream of mushroom soup
1 cup fat-free sour cream
1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on black pepper
1 cup light shredded Cheddar cheese
3/4 cup sliced green onions
32-ounce bag frozen tater tots
optional: chicken, for added protein
If you add chicken to this Weight Watchers Tater Tot Casserole, use boneless skinless chicken breast to add protein for 0 points! Then this would be a one-pan meal, perfect for the whole family!
Heat oven to 350°F. Spray baking dish with cooking spray. Mix condensed soup, 1/2 cup sour cream, the garlic powder, salt, pepper and 1/2 cup of the cheese until mixed well. Stir in chicken (if using) and 1/2 cup of the green onions.
Place half of the frozen tater tots in single layer on bottom of your baking dish. Spread mixture on top of potatoes. Top with remaining potatoes.
Bake for 45 minutes. Top casserole with remaining 1/2 cup cheese. Bake 10 minutes longer, until cheese is melted. Top with remaining sour cream and top with remaining 1/4 cup sliced green onions.
